// Hello plugin authors! This constant defines the maximum nesting depth
// the Inkmill markdown pipeline will render before bailing out. Your plugin's
// transforms run inside this limit too, so if you generate deeply nested
// blockquotes or lists programmatically, keep it reasonable or the renderer
// will truncate with a warning node. We bumped it once and regretted it —
// pathological inputs got slow fast. The token for the pipeline build this
// limit was last tuned against appears directly below.

session token of taduf-tahog = htk4_91a1

**Runbook: Canary Gating — Skylark Deploys**

Before promoting a canary beyond 5% traffic, verify all three gates: error rate must stay under 0.3% for 30 minutes, p95 latency within 10% of baseline, and no new crash signatures in the Wrenfield aggregator. If any gate fails, the Skylark controller auto-halts and pages the on-call. Do not override gates manually without two approvals from the deploy channel. When filing the promotion record, include the canary's build identifier directly below.

build token for tafop-haduf: htk31_7289156dd3fe39a42066f8714f71d27

## QueuePilot 2.7 — Default Changes

The queue-depth autoscaler now evaluates depth over a rolling five-minute window instead of instantaneous samples, and the scale-down cooldown has been lengthened to reduce thrash during bursty loads. Release managers should expect slower downscaling after traffic spikes; this is intentional. The new default values shipping with 2.7 are as follows.

deployment values, kajep-kageg:
[praix]
host = praix.paliqcorp.corp
user = praix_svc
database = praix_prod

// Broker upgrade notes for plugin authors:
// Quillbus 4.x replaces the legacy 3.x wire protocol. Plugins must
// construct the client with explicit protocol negotiation enabled,
// or connections to the Larkfield cluster will be silently downgraded
// and dropped after 30s. Topic names are unchanged. For local testing
// against the sandbox broker, authenticate with the key below.

API key for bafof-bagaf: qvz2-qi